Biblical history and the shorter prophets have lessons for twenty-first century Christians that are too often missed in regular study. Of Kings, Prophets, Families, and the King of Kings examines these often-neglected Scriptures, using various techniques to tell these truths in modern forms for modern times. The historical books and the shorter prophets contain critical teaching concerning human nature, politics, and the coming climax of human historywhen the conflict between God and Satan bursts out into spiritual and physical warfare without restraint as described in Revelation and elsewhere in the Bible. If knowledge is power, then the verses explored here may be some of the most powerful in the world. This guide provides a springboard into vital portions of Scripture that are virtually unknown to most believers. It offers a helpful introduction to these overlooked passages, so that others might read and study them, gaining wisdom from the Scriptures and from the Holy Spirit who inspired them.
